The Evolution of Thematic Slot Gaming
Traditional slot machines, historically rooted in simple fruit symbols and basic mechanics, have transformed dramatically in the digital era. The advent of high-quality graphics, sound design, and complex bonus features have elevated online slots into multimedia entertainment platforms. Furthermore, thematic diversity now plays a critical role. From mythological epics and adventure stories to pop culture references, tailored themes serve to deepen player immersion and increase retention rates.

Designing for the Future: Trends in Themed Slot Development
Looking ahead, several key trends are shaping the future of themed slot design:
- Hybrid Themes and Genre Blending: Mixing horror with humour, adventure with fantasy, or science fiction with historical elements will continue to diversify game portfolios.
- Storytelling Integration: Embedding narrative arcs with character development and episodic content to build an ongoing player saga.
- Enhanced Interactivity: Combining aug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) to deepen immersion, especially within thematic worlds like zombie apocalypses or farmyard comedies.
- Personalization: Adaptive gaming experiences tailored to individual preferences, leveraging artificial intelligence and data analytics.
